Though West Kirby station lacks a dedicated ticket office, it is equipped with ticket machines where you can easily purchase or collect your pre-booked tickets. For those embracing the digital age, smartcards are both issued and validated at the station. Accessibility is a priority here, with step-free access provided throughout, ensuring a comfortable experience for all passengers. You can rely on the help point for assistance, as well as customer help points that are available at the station.
Despite the station's conveniences, it currently does not offer luggage storage, waiting rooms, or accessible toilets. Yet, for an optimally balanced pitstop, visitors can enjoy a hot drink from the café or grab a quick snack from vending machines. Though there's no public Wi-Fi, it's a great excuse to "switch off" and admire the seaside charm of West Kirby.
Although West Kirby train station doesn't offer a taxi service directly at its doorstep, onward travel is readily facilitated via buses. The local bus services can be checked on the official Merseytravel website, or by contacting Traveline for comprehensive travel advice. Moreover, connections to Liverpool John Lennon Airport are convenient as you can purchase a combined rail and bus ticket to travel seamlessly to the airport from any Merseyrail station.

Though Nutfield Station may seem modest with its lack of a ticket office, it compensates with a well-equipped ticket machine for all your buying and collection needs. The machine is accessible and supports Disabled Persons Railcard discounts, making it accommodating for all passengers. However, it's important to note there are no waiting rooms or refreshment facilities, so plan accordingly. CCTV coverage offers reassurance for safety, but the absence of station staff means passengers must rely on designated help points for assistance. For those requiring additional support, pre-booking assistance is recommended to ensure smooth travels.
Accessibility is a priority here with partial step-free access available at the station, catering particularly to individuals with mobility issues. There's a long step-free route between platforms, but when transferring between train and platform, assistance might be needed as ramps are only staff-operated. Though the station lacks staff presence most of the time, assistance can be requested via the help points or the Assisted Travel helpline.
